MMORPGs

MMORPGs, or massively multiplayer online role-playing games, are another popular type of multiplayer game. These games allow you to create your own character and explore a vast virtual world filled with other players, delivering an immersive game experience that feels deeper than any other kind of game. Some of the most popular MMORPGs include World of Warcraft, Final Fantasy XIV, and Guild Wars 2. With quests, dungeons, and raids to complete, there’s always something to do in these games.

MOBAs

MOBAs, or multiplayer online battle arenas, are fast-paced games that require teamwork and strategy to win. In these games, you work with a team of other players to defeat the opposing team in a battle arena. Popular MOBAs include League of Legends, Dota 2, and Smite. With a wide variety of characters to choose from and constantly evolving gameplay, MOBAs offer endless hours of entertainment.

Management simulations

There is one management simulation that stands out above the others – the Football Manager franchise. If you’re a fan of the round-ball game, it’s one of the most captivating games you’ll ever play, as you take on the role of a club manager controlling real players, real teams and even real nations as you seek to test your tactical acumen against the best – or at least AI versions of the best. Multiplayer games allow you to take this up a notch, pitting yourself against the best Football Manager players, or just taking rivalry with your friends to the next level by battling one another to be the best manager among you.

Collaborative browser/app games

It started with Farmville, and has just grown from there. Usually played on your phone, these games allow you to build from humble beginnings and create an empire of sorts. It might be a farm, it may be a whole town, or an entire civilization, but either way, these games are highly popular and appeal to an exceptionally wide audience that genuinely fulfills the person specification “from eight to eighty”. An underrated element of these games is that you can help out your co-players with items or hard work, and they’ll do the same in return for you.

First-person Shooters

First-person shooters, or FPS games, are another popular type of multiplayer game. These games allow you to compete against other players in fast-paced shooting matches. Popular FPS games include Call of Duty, Battlefield, and Counter-Strike. With a variety of game modes and maps to choose from, FPS games offer a thrilling and competitive gaming experience. There are even online-based shooters, such as the thrilling and madcap Korean browser game Sudden Attack, in which you can lie in wait to pick off your friends, or provide covering fire for them as they go after digitised opponents: whichever you prefer.
